Understanding the Value of Climate in Exterior Painting
Weather plays an essential function in the success of an external paint task. Irregularity in temperature, moisture, wind speed, and precipitation can all impact drying out times, bond, and general finish quality. Consequently, being mindful of climate patterns is paramount for any kind of homeowner or contractor.
Key Climate Variables to Consider
Temperature: Ideal temperatures for a lot of external paints vary between 50 ° F and 85 ° F. Extreme warmth can create paint to dry too quickly, while chilly temperature levels can stop appropriate curing.
Humidity: High humidity degrees can increase drying times and may lead to problems like mold growth. On the other hand, low moisture can accelerate evaporation.
Wind: Windy conditions can present dirt and debris into damp paint, leading to an uneven finish.
Precipitation: Rainfall can wash away fresh paint or cause it to run prior to it dries properly.
Sunlight Exposure: Direct sunshine can heat up surface areas excessively, triggering paint to bubble or peel.
Planning for Seasonal Changes
As seasons adjustment, so do climate condition. Each season provides its own collection of challenges for exterior painting.
Spring Painting Strategies
Spring frequently supplies modest temperature levels suitable for painting; nonetheless, shower prevail.
- Best Practices: Check neighborhood forecasts regularly. Plan job during completely dry spells. Use moisture-resistant primers.
Summer Painting Tips
Summer brings warmth but also extreme sunshine that can trigger paint to dry also fast.

- Best Practices: Paint early in the morning or late in the evening. Use reflective tarpaulins to secure surface areas from direct sunlight. Opt for high-grade outdoor paints developed for warm conditions.
Autumn Considerations
Fall is typically an attractive time for paint but includes its own challenges like dropping temperature levels at night.
- Best Practices: Start jobs early in the day when temperature levels are still warm. Ensure surfaces are completely dry from early morning dew prior to using paint. Keep an eye on nighttime temperatures which should stay above freezing.
Winter Challenges
Winter is normally viewed as a no-go period for outside painting as a result of cool temperature levels and snow risks.
- Best Practices: If absolutely needed, usage specialized winter-grade paints developed to heal at reduced temperatures. Work on protected locations that minimize exposure to severe elements.

Selecting High quality Paint Products
Not all paints are developed equal; selecting top quality products developed for outdoor usage is essential.
Types of Outside Paints
Acrylic Latex Paints: Exceptional adaptability and adherence residential properties make them suitable for different climates.
Oil-Based Paints: Offer sturdiness however require longer drying out times; not advised in damp conditions as a result of slow curing.
Elastomeric Coatings: Ideal for locations with severe weather condition changes due to their ability to expand and get without cracking.
Preparing Surfaces Before Painting
Preparation is crucial to attaining a lasting coating:
Cleaning: Eliminate dirt, mold, mildew, and peeling paint utilizing ideal cleaners or stress cleaning techniques.
Repairing Damages: Fill up fractures or openings with caulking or putty; guarantee surfaces are smooth prior to priming.
Priming: Apply a quality guide fit for outside usage; this action boosts attachment while obstructing discolorations from bleeding with the topcoat.
